Fable Podcast Details Bowerstone and One-Versus-Many Combat

Microsoft and Playground Games released an official podcast for Fable, the open-world action RPG targeting a February 23, 2027 release on PS5 and Xbox Series X|S. Ralph Fulton of Playground Games described Bowerstone, a dense city with verticality where players enter every house and shop without loading screens. Combat is built around one person versus many, mixing sword strikes, crossbow fire, and charge-based magic.

The podcast runs about 20 minutes and centers on Bowerstone, the city that represents Albion. Its buildings are individually crafted to reflect residents' lifestyles and social status, and players can buy a house as a base or break in as a burglar to steal household goods.

Combat is designed around group battles of one person versus many. Enemies named include skeletons, wraiths, and heavily armored Hollow Folk. Players combine sword strikes, crossbow attacks, and magic whose nature changes with charge time, with synergies such as launching enemies into the air and striking them with lightning.

The opening has the protagonist, whose village and grandmother were turned to stone, leaving Bower Hill for Albion. Heading to the Heroes' Guild as instructed or exploring freely is the player's choice.
